Understanding Travertine Cuts

The visual character of travertine depends entirely on the direction the raw block is sawed relative to the natural sedimentary bedding planes:

Vein Cut (Horizontal Banding)

Blocks are sawed parallel to the bedding veins. This exposes the horizontal sedimentary layers, creating sleek, modern parallel band lines.

Cross Cut (Flowing Clouds)

Blocks are sawed perpendicular to the bedding veins. This creates a circular, cloud-like floral pattern showing concentric natural swirls.

Filled vs Unfilled Finishes

Naturally occurring travertine contains small vacuum pockets. We process slabs to fit specific application requirements:

  • Honed Unfilled: Holes are left open. Exudes a raw, organic texture. Perfect for exterior wall claddings.
  • Honed/Polished Filled: Cavities are filled with a specialized matching cement or transparent polyester epoxy, then sanded flush. Perfect for interior bathroom floorings to prevent dirt accumulation.

Travertine Applications

Luxury Hotels

Ideal for lobbies, grand halls, and textured columns that require an organic, historical feel.

Flooring

Filled and honed flooring tiles that provide a smooth walk surface with slip-resistant features.

Facades

Drilled cladding slabs for high-rise buildings. Offers high wind-load resistance and low heat retention.

Outdoor Projects

Unfilled brushed travertine pool copings and luxury garden pavers that remain cool under direct sunlight.
